Doom's ally, Egghead, hatches a scheme to steal a fractal in the Squad's Helicarrier by shrinking to insect-size. Fortunately, the Squad can count on Ant-Man to help them chase down the villains at micro-scale. But being super-small leads them into some very unpleasant places, including Hulk's nose.
It's a super-team team-up as the Squad helps out the Fantastic Four with an ambush from the alien Skrulls and Super-Skrull. Meanwhile, Dr. Doom is making a devious deal with a mysterious cosmic villain named Thanos. As the battle rages in the Baxter Building and outer space, our heroes find that both threats are connected and they may have to make a deal of their own to save the Earth!
A new heroine named the Black Widow joins the team and shows the boys she can kick butt even better than them. But we soon learn she is really the shape-shifting Mystique, sent by Doom to infiltrate and get at the fractals. She nearly succeeds and leads the Squad into a Lethal Legion ambush. But Nick Fury may just have provided their ace in the hole… Screaming Mimi turns on the villains, revealing herself to be an undercover SHIELD agent named Songbird!
A fractal mishap finally gives M.O.D.O.K. his big chance to overthrow Dr. Doom. But with Loki's manipulations driving his big head even bigger, M.O.D.O.K. becomes an omnipotent threat to other villains and the city itself. Even the Squad (with the Black Panther's help) can't outwit "Mo-Dork". But just maybe Iron Man can inspire Dr. Doom to get his mojo back and team-up against M.O.D.O.K..
Supernatural wackiness is turning the city (and the Squad) upside-down. The Squad goes to the mysterious Dr. Strange for help, but Strange tricks them into battling the dread Dormammu. It seems a wayward fractal is stuck in the Eye of Agomotto – but can the heroes possibly free Dr. Strange from the fractal's influence, defeat Dormammu and rescue the city from an army of Mindless Ones, all at the same time?
"Candid Camera Murder Incident": Nobuo and his mother are put in great danger after the young photography hoaxer finally captures a shot to die for. Nobody believes what he has to say at first, but when the pictures happens to pin a member of The Iron Cross Army to a murder scene, it's up to Spider-Man to clear the boy's name. Uncovering a plot to take over Japan using experimental "Scrap gas," Spider-Man not only has the Iron Cross Army testing his skills but also the corrupt dealings of a ruthless tycoon who will stop at nothing to see his plans played out.
"The Incredible Wild Girl Who Bullies Boys": Professor Monster orders the Iron Cross Army to capture a young girl possessing an amulet from Planet Spider after her pictures were published in a local newspaper. While reading that same newspaper, Takuya also notices the amulet and decides to approach the young girl. After learning her story and how she obtained the pendant, Spiderman must make sure that the Professor Monster and his Iron Cross Army will never get their hands on the prized amulet.
An ancient magician frozen in time by a rival sorcerer is brought back to life in the present day by a deranged college professor. Bent on conquering the world, the resurrected magician creates chaos inside the university and around the city until Spider-Man shows up to save the day. Faced with powerful thousand year-old magic, Spider-Man must find a way to defeat one of the most powerful villains he's ever encountered.
A new villain, The Chameleon, is impersonating other people through an image-inducing belt and plans to assassinate two major diplomats on the brink of signing an important peace proposal. But the Chameleon makes a misstep when he unwisely takes the appearance of Peter Parker while Spider-Man is around. Spider-Man battles his doppelganger to ensure that the peace treaty goes according to plan.
Xavier and Magneto are held captive by Mister Sinister and are used as bait to the lure the X-Men into an ambush at the Savage Land Castle. After capturing the X-Men, Sinister unfolds a plan to use their genetic material to modify Magneto's lowly band of 'mutates' into more powerful and deadly mutants.
A cunning "cat" burglar is on a stealing spree and there seems to be no way to catch the elusive thief. Meanwhile, a movie premiere comes to town and the rich and famous all come to see the new attraction, only to find themselves in Pardo's trap! Using a mystical pet cat to hypnotize the audience, Pardo steals all their belongings, but what the villain doesn't know is that Peter Parker is in the theater. Spider-Man soon finds himself in a battle with Pardo and must stop the trickster before the fight spills out into the city!
Spider-Man's latest caper takes the wall crawler far away from the familiar skyscrapers of New York City and into a dark realm of horrible monsters and menacing overlords. After picking up a disturbing distress call through his "Spider-sense" Spider-Man eagerly takes a state of the art jet-plane for a test drive over the ocean. It is here that Spidey finds the source of the mysterious message and decides to take on the evil "Dr. Manta," and his army of robotic insects to save a lost civilization from destruction.
Yuriko's alien discovery, a Shi'ar vessel, turns out to be a prison cell containing a voracious, gaseous prisoner, the M'Kraan Spirit Drinker. It immediately sucks life out of Yuriko and her cohorts, the Reavers, and turns its attention to the X-Men. The X-Men must change their strategy to defeat an enemy they can't touch.
"The Onion Iron Mask and the Youth Detective Club": Professor Monster enlists the help of an old colleague named Dr. Miracle to eliminate Spiderman once and for all. While landing on earth, a member of the Youth Detective Club notices Dr. Miracle and decides to investigate further, but when Dr. Miracle turns the tables and attacks the children, Spiderman must swing into action and defeat the powerful foe.
While on a plane in a distant country, Peter Parker finds himself in the midst of a heavy thunderstorm that causes his plane to crash. Peter ends up in the middle of an unchartered jungle amongst hostile natives and strange beasts. Now Spider-Man must do his best to keep the plane crew safe, while somehow finding a way to get them home in one-piece.
It's a race against time for Spider-Man as the classic villain "The Mole" returns with a vengeance. With the buildings of New York disappearing one by one it's up to Spidey to save the day. Relying on his "Spider-hearing," to decipher a cryptic message, Peter Parker swings into action. This time it's an adventure below ground as Spider-Man must outrun a race of elves, outwit a subterranean rock giant and of course overcome the underground Kingdom of "The Mole People" before it's too late. Beast falls in love with Carly, a blind patient of his. The two are kept apart by Carly's father who looks down upon the mutant race. But when the Friends of Humanity (an anti-mutant organization) kidnaps Carly, her father turns to Beast who must now risk his life to try and save her.
"The Secret Emissary from Hell, the Enma Devil": An old man obsessed with the occult discovers that The Enma Devil has been resurrected from the dead and his son takes off to ask Spiderman for help. Meanwhile, Takuya senses that something is wrong after an unusual thunderstorm falls on the city and decides to investigate further. After finding the boy, Spiderman realizes that a great evil has been unleashed on the city and must somehow defeat the powerful being and keep it from killing the boy.
While unwinding at a club, Peter Parker meets a girl named Carol who is surprisingly as interested in science as he is. After setting up a date, Peter decides to patrol the town as Spider-Man and stumbles upon a robbery perpetrated by...Carol! But things start to look fishy when Carol starts using the same spider powers as Spider-Man. Spider-Man follows her as she races back to their headquarters and discovers that they are from a distant civilization that crash landed one Earth and have been living underground waiting to be saved.
''Diamond Dust'': Museum robbers disguised as gorillas create a diversion by unlocking a zoo cage and stealing valuable items while the wild animals occupy the security. Spider-Man discovers the devious plan and corrals the freed animals in time to get to the bottom of the heist.
